The following are the special categories for admission: Kashmir Migrant (KM), Mewat Area Residents (MAR), Haryana Government School Topper (HGST), Shivalik Development Board (SDB), Tuition Fee Waiver (TFW). Check below in detail: HSTES Kashmir Migrant Seats: The number of seats under this scheme is 5% of the sanctioned intake of each course. The seats will be supernumerary in nature and will be filled separately on the basis of inter-se-merit in the qualifying examination. The Department of Technical Education, Haryana, will conduct the online HSTES counselling.

The scores of the following exams are used for selection of the candidates via HSTES counselling:
- JEE Main - BE/BTech
- NATA/JEE Main paper 2 - BArch
- OCET (Online common entrance test) - BPharm
- Qualifying exam - Diploma and LE courses

The admission process via HSTES counselling includes: Online registration and deposition of registration fees, OCET (Online common entrance test) only for BPharm candidates, Document upload and verification, Merit list display (except BE/BTech), Choice filling and locking, Seat allotment, Reporting at allotted college

Choice filling is one of the stages of the HSTES counselling process. After the HSTES counselling registration and document verification, candidates can log in to select their preferred courses and colleges from the available options. The number of seats at each institution will be displayed based on eligibility and category. Candidates will only see options for which they are eligible.

Candidates have to fill the HSTES application form with name, address, qualifying exam marks, contact number, email id, etc. Along with personal details, academic qualifications like Class 10 and Class 12 marksheets and certificates and they need to upload scanned copies of signature and passport size photograph.
